Offshore supply tug SAAVEDRA TIDE was attacked by pirates on December 4, 2018 at around 1800 UTC in vicinity 03 10N 006 20E, 23 nm west of tug’s destination, EGINA FPSO (IMO 9695896), Egina Oil Field, Bight of Bonny, Nigeria.
It is not known what happened exactly, but it is believed, that pirates managed to board the ship. Later it was said, that the crew and the ship were safe and returned to unnamed port. According to track, the ship docked at Brass Oil Terminal in the morning Dec 5. Hopefully, persons in charge said the truth and crew are safe. No other details available at the moment.
Offshore supply tug SAAVEDRA TIDE, IMO 9697090, dwt 4668, built 2016, flag Vanuatu, operator TIDEWATER Marine LCC, Houston.
